Airworthiness Directives (ADs)

CAA-2006-10-010

The aircraft owner or operator shall comply with Airworthiness Directives issued by the CAA or the aeronautics authority of the State of Design (SoD) of the aviation products, appliances and parts, and take all necessary actions thereto.

Issue Date
2006/10/18
Applicability
AIRBUS A330 aircraft, all certified models, all serial numbers, on which AIRBUS modification 49144 (install rudder fly by wire) has been embodied in production except those on which AIRBUS modification 55185 has been embodied in production or AIRBUS Service Bulletin (SB) A330-27-3142 has been embodied in service. AIRBUS aircraft A340-200 and A340-300 series, all certified models, all serial numbers, on which AIRBUS modification 49144 has been embodied in production except those on which AIRBUS modification 55185 has been embodied in production or AIRBUS SB A340-27-4142 has been embodied in service. AIRBUS aircraft A340-500 and A340-600 series, all certified models, all serial numbers, except those on which AIRBUS modification 55186 has been embodied in production or AIRBUS SB A340-27-5036 has been embodied in service.

Subject
Flight Controls – Back-up Control Module (BCM) –Operational Test /Replacement
Reference Publications (Revision/ATA/SB)
ATA 27 AIRBUS SB A330-27-3147, SB A330-27-3142, SB A340-27-4147, SB A340-27-4142, SB A340-27-5038 or SB A340-27-5036.
